First Tourismo delivered to Donoghues of Galway

routeone Team
routeone Team
Published: May 15, 2017
Share
SHARE
The new Tourismo is the first for Donoghues and it has 55 seats

Irish operator Donoghues of Galway has taken delivery of its first Mercedes-Benz Tourismo, supplied by EvoBus (UK) (02476 626000).

It is built to Travel specification and seats 55 passengers in Travel Star Eco upholstery with leather headrests. Matching pleated curtains are also fitted.

Power comes from an OM 470 engine rated at 390bhp driving through the eight-speed Powershift automated manual gearbox.

Passengers’ safety is assured by the Tourismo’s standard Electronic Stability Programme and Lane Departure Warning system. The coach will be used on various work by the Failte Ireland-accredited operator.
